For example, to achieve MERV-13, a filter has to catch 90% of particles in the 3-10 µm range, 85% of particles in the 1-3 µm range (where PM2.5 is), and 50% of particles in the range 0.3-1 µm range (the really, really small stuff). Filters with a MERV-A rating have been manufactured to a MERV value without relying on an electrostatic charge, so they maintain the indicated efficiency for their entire service life. Second, if faced with a MERV-13 regulatory mandate and budgetary concerns that prevent the first choice, then 2-inch MERV-13 (not MERV-13A) air filters could be sourced, but be aware that the actual performance of MERV 13 air filters will be closer to MERV-8 after a period of time. Viruses are roughly 100 times smaller than bacteria, and typically range from 0.004 to 0.1 microns in size.
